bwilliams wrote:
I believe Alocasia Hilo Beauty is a caladium or possibly a Colocasia X Caladium cross. Only looking at it's DNA will they probably ever really figure out what it is. As for how large they get. I have grown them to 3 maybe 4 feet here. But recently I have seen a new form aparently a tetraploid or hexiploid form. I am not sure where this form is from but it can get 5 to 6 feet tall. If the genes are a even number maybe it will start producing flowers now. Perhaps it was a tetraploid Caladium to start off and now its chromosomes have been doubled if so giving a even number and a chance for breeding. Here is the new beast I am not sure what they are calling it at the moment. But from the stems and leaves you can tell it is different than the regular form. This form in the picture was pulled because it was variegated.
